Job description

Description

The Regional Clinic Manager will oversee the day-to-day operations of our clinics, ensuring that both clinical and operational functions run smoothly, efficiently, and with a strong focus on patient satisfaction. As a leader in our healthcare team, the Regional Clinic Manager will be responsible for ensuring optimal patient flow, provider productivity, and staff performance, while maintaining the highest standards of care. The Regional Clinical Manager will also ensure that all services align with our core values emphasizing quality, access, and patient engagement. Valley Oaks Medical Group is now Astrana Care of Nevada. At Valley Oaks, we strive to redefine the way healthcare is administered through community driven preventative care and proactive treatment. By centering care around the patient, we can improve health and wellbeing instead of treating symptoms. Our passionate providers prioritize the wellness of each of our patients with the necessary tools and resources to improve the quality of life for all of our patients. Our Values : Put Patients First Empower Entrepreneurial Provider and Care Teams Operate with Integrity & Excellence Be Innovative Work As One Team

What You'll Do

  • Directly supervise clinical and administrative staff, ensuring they are trained, supported, and performing effectively.
  • Oversee day-to-day clinic operations, ensuring efficient patient flow, minimal wait times, and timely care delivery.
  • Monitor and improve provider productivity while ensuring quality care standards are maintained.
  • Ensure the clinic delivers patient-centered care that prioritizes patient satisfaction and engagement.
  • Manage patient scheduling, communication, and follow-up to optimize care delivery.
  • Address patient and staff concerns in a timely manner to maintain a positive clinic environment.
  • Implement strategies to enhance clinic efficiency, reduce operational bottlenecks, and improve service delivery.
  • Ensure compliance with healthcare regulations, policies, procedures, and quality measures.
  • Support continuous quality improvement initiatives and the evaluation of clinical outcomes.
  • Prepare for and support regulatory audits, inspections, and reviews.
  • Foster a collaborative and positive work environment, encouraging teamwork and open communication.
  • Collaborate with leadership to develop strategies for improving patient care and operational performance.
  • Track and report key performance indicators (KPIs) for both clinical and operational outcomes.
  • Maintain inventory and manage clinic resources to ensure availability and functionality.
  • Coordinate with other healthcare providers and departments to ensure coordinated care for patients
